Traditional General Ecology is often limiting, with concepts like "ecosystem" remaining ambiguous (O'Neil et al., 1986). Critics argue that ecology is merely a tool for environmental management-addressed by administrators, engineers, and other professionals-rather than a branch of biology focused on meso and micro-scale phenomena.
